Timing tower (left panel)

The classic F1 timing tower:

ColumnMeaning
PosCurrent race position (1–22)
Code3-letter driver code
GapTime gap to leader (e.g. +12.3 or +1L) — turns red when negative drift, green when closing
PitPit stops done count
CompoundCurrent tire — S (Soft) / H (Hard)
Last lapMost recent lap time

Your drivers are highlighted (background colour). Click a row to select that driver as the camera focus.

Reading the gap

  • +0.5 to a rival = within DRS-equivalent window — overtake possible
  • +1.0 to +2.0 = engagement window — pressure builds, mistakes possible
  • +2.0 to +5.0 = neutral — no engagement
  • +5.0+ = clear air — drivers settle into pace

A green gap = you’re closing on the rival. A red gap = they’re pulling away.


Mini-sector delta panel (right)

Each lap is divided into 12 mini-sectors (timing lines around the track). Per-driver, this panel shows:

  • Current lap split: time at each mini-sector
  • Best lap split: your driver’s session best
  • Delta to best: green if faster, red if slower — per mini-sector

This is how you see where lap time is being lost or gained — not just the total lap time, but the section-level breakdown.

Use cases

  • Identify weak sectors — e.g. driver consistently loses 0.3s in mini-sectors 5–6 (a slow corner sequence)
  • Track wear progression — late-stint laps show progressive deltas to mid-stint best (the wear curve in action)
  • Out-lap recovery — see how cold tires cost lap time over the first 2 mini-sectors

Per-driver controls

Per-driver bars at the bottom show:

IndicatorMeaning
Driver code + colourIdentifies which car
Tire compound + tempVisual gauge — green = optimal, blue = cold, red = overheating
Tire wear bar0–100%+ — green / yellow / red as it fills
Fuel gaugeCurrent kg + estimated laps remaining
Engine map widget0–10 slider (you click to change)
Push toggleON/OFF
L&C toggleON/OFF
Stay Behind / Let PassON/OFF (only when applicable)
Pit buttonManual override to commit pit at next opportunity

Quick read

A healthy car will show all green: tires in window, plenty of fuel, no warnings. As the race progresses:

  • Yellow on tire wear gauge → entering wear cliff zone
  • Yellow on tire temp → drifting out of optimal window
  • Yellow engine warning → +10°C overheat
  • Orange engine warning → +25°C overheat (real damage)
  • Red imminent failure → 30%+ countdown active, pit immediately

Track view (centre)

The 2D track shows live car positions. Visual cues:

  • Car body colour = team colour
  • Lateral offset = car drifts left/right of racing line during overtakes / mistakes / sliding
  • Sliding indicator = visual yaw offset when tire load > 85%
  • Crash particles = active crash physics (debris, smoke, sparks)
  • Yellow flag overlay = sector(s) with yellow flag
  • SC overlay = orange flashing lights when Safety Car is on track
  • Pit lane = parallel track segment, cars visible during pit stops

Click a car to centre the camera; double-click to follow.

Camera modes

  • Free — fixed view of the whole track
  • Follow — locked to your selected driver
  • Panoramic — wide view with multiple cars in frame

Commentary feed (bottom)

Coloured lines describe events as they happen:

ColourMeaning
🟢 GreenPositive (overtake, fast lap, fastest sector)
🟡 YellowCaution (close call, dirty air pressure)
🟠 OrangeWarning (mistake, mechanical warning)
🔴 RedCritical (crash, DNF, mechanical failure imminent)
⚪ White / CustomNeutral / generic info

Commentary is prioritised — high-priority lines (crashes) push older lines off the visible window first. The full event log is accessible via the D key (data center).


Data Center (D key)

The data center has tabbed panels:

Standings

Live championship table — driver standings + constructor standings, updated every lap.

Strategy

Per-car pit strategy view — what plan they’re on, next planned stop, fuel target, compound queued. Useful for spotting rival undercut attempts.

Analysis

Lap chart, gap chart, sector deltas — detailed multi-driver comparisons. Use this to see who’s gaining ground, who’s pace is fading.

Telemetry (if telemetry_enabled = true in race_config)

Per-tick CSV recording streams here. Mostly post-race analysis.

Reading the race at a glance

Here’s the 5-second priority scan:

  1. Position bar (top of timing tower) — am I where I expected?
  2. Gap to driver ahead (timing tower) — closing or pulling away?
  3. Tire wear gauge (per-driver bar) — green or yellow?
  4. Fuel gauge — enough to reach the flag?
  5. Engine warning — any yellow / orange / red?

If all green: cruise. If any yellow/orange: take action (pit, lift, reduce map). If red: emergency action immediately.


Mid-race CSV dump (Shift+F12)

Hits Shift+F12 to dump CSV files for post-race analysis:

FileContents
positions_midrace_{timestamp}.csvSnapshot of every car’s state right now (~27 columns)
overtakes_midrace_{timestamp}.csvAll overtake events
collisions_midrace_{timestamp}.csvAll collision events
close_calls_midrace_{timestamp}.csvLateral proximity events
ai_decisions_midrace_{timestamp}.csvFull AI decision audit trail
pit_crew_* / pitwall_crew_*.csvPit crew positions / activities

These are dev tools mainly, but they’re available to any player who wants to analyse a race in detail.
